Why are people A. Wasting their money? and B. Using their own brand loyalty to convince the OP what to do?

Go to http://www.av-comparatives.org/ , click on the "main comparatives" link just above the list of AV Software and read through both the latest On-Demand Comparative and Retrospective/Proactive Test.

To give you a taste of what you will be reading: NOD32 is fairly good but is below even free offerings (Avira, Avast, MSE) depending what you value.

I also think that its proven to have the best defence against viruses because of that its worth its money every year.

That's my point. You haven't shown anything (impartial) to indicate how good it is. Going by AV-Comparatives:

MSE is a far better proactive scanner (Free)
Avast is a far better on-demand scanner (Free)

G Data AntiVirus & Trustport Antivirus wipe the floor with everything if you wish to pay.

Infact Avira Free is a better AV than NOD32 (unless the features of the Premium version make a massive difference)...
